Is Ferritin 470 ng/mL Low, Normal, or High?
Ferritin 470 ng/mL indicates that your body's iron storage capacity might be quite robust, often considered higher than the typical healthy range for many adults. This level suggests a notable accumulation of iron, stored in a protein called ferritin, which acts like your body's personal iron warehouse. While this Ferritin 470 ng/mL reading isn't extremely high, it certainly moves beyond what is usually seen as a comfortable or normal range. Understanding what this specific level means for your overall well-being and long-term health can be a crucial next step, prompting a closer look at your body's iron balance.
A ferritin of 470 ng/mL is 57% above the upper reference limit of 300 ng/mL, 170 ng/mL above normal. At this exact level, elevated ferritin may reflect inflammation (ferritin is an acute-phase reactant), metabolic syndrome, liver disease, or early iron overload. CRP and transferrin saturation help distinguish inflammatory from iron-loading causes.

Diet Changes for Ferritin 470 ng/mL
When your ferritin level is 470 ng/mL, exploring certain dietary adjustments can be a proactive way to influence your body's iron balance over the long haul. The goal isn't to eliminate iron entirely, as it's an essential mineral, but rather to subtly reduce the absorption of readily available iron and promote overall well-being. Focusing on a balanced diet rich in plant-based foods can be beneficial, as these foods often contain non-heme iron, which is absorbed less efficiently than heme iron found in animal products. The World Health Organization (WHO) often emphasizes balanced nutrition as a cornerstone of health, which can include strategies for managing mineral levels like this Ferritin 470 ng/mL.
- **Increase plant-based iron sources**: Prioritize fruits, vegetables, and whole grains, which contain non-heme iron that is less readily absorbed. Pair these with foods high in vitamin C *separately* from high-iron meals, as vitamin C boosts iron absorption.
- **Limit heme iron intake**: Moderating the consumption of red meat, especially organ meats, which are rich in heme iron, can help manage overall iron load contributing to your Ferritin 470 ng/mL level, supporting a healthier balance over time.
- **Incorporate iron inhibitors**: Foods like black tea, coffee, and calcium-rich dairy products can inhibit iron absorption when consumed with meals. This approach supports a long-term strategy for a more balanced iron profile from Ferritin 470 ng/mL.
Ferritin 470 ng/mL in Men, Women, Elderly, and Kids
Understanding a Ferritin 470 ng/mL reading requires considering individual factors like age and biological sex, as iron metabolism can vary significantly across different groups. For adult men, a level of Ferritin 470 ng/mL is often more concerning because men typically do not experience regular blood loss like menstruating women. This means that any excess iron they absorb tends to accumulate over time, potentially leading to higher risk for long-term complications. For women who are still menstruating, this level might also be elevated, but the context of their cycle and any potential blood loss conditions would be important for interpretation of Ferritin 470 ng/mL. After menopause, women's iron metabolism tends to resemble that of men, and a Ferritin 470 ng/mL in post-menopausal women would carry similar implications for long-term iron accumulation. In older adults, chronic inflammation, which can naturally increase with age, can also elevate ferritin levels even without true iron overload. Therefore, assessing the complete picture, including inflammatory markers, becomes especially important to accurately interpret Ferritin 470 ng/mL in this age group and guide long-term management strategies. For children, a Ferritin 470 ng/mL is usually very high and would warrant prompt investigation, as their iron needs and regulatory systems are different, and such a level could signal significant underlying issues requiring careful long-term follow-up. These demographic differences highlight why personal context is key in understanding the long-term trajectory of iron stores when dealing with Ferritin 470 ng/mL.

Yes, ferritin is an acute phase reactant, meaning its levels can rise in response to inflammation or infection, even without true iron overload. A Ferritin 470 ng/mL could indeed signal an underlying inflammatory condition, even if you don't feel acutely ill. Your doctor might consider additional tests to check for inflammation or other health issues that could be contributing to this elevated Ferritin 470 ng/mL.
